感谢阅读本文 随着互联网安全意识的提高,越来越多的网站开始使用HTTPS来保护用户数据的安全。SSL(Secure Sockets Layer)证书是实现HTTPS的关键,它能够在用户和服务器之间建立一个加密的通道,确保数据传输的安全性。对于许多个人网站或小型企业来说,购买SSL证书可能会带来额外的成本。幸运的是,现在有免费的方式可以获得SSL证书,本文将指导您如何申请免费的SSL证书。 **什么是SSL证书?** SSL证书是一种数字证书,由受信任的证书颁发机构(CA)颁发,用于在互联网通信中验证网站的身份,并在用户和服务器之间建立加密连接。这可以防止中间人攻击,并确保数据的完整性和机密性。 **为什么需要SSL证书?** SSL证书不仅保护了用户数据的安全,还能提高网站的信誉。许多浏览器会对没有使用HTTPS的网站发出警告,这可能会影响用户体验和网站的信任度。此外,搜索引擎如Google也会优先考虑使用HTTPS的网站。 **如何申请免费的SSL证书?** 目前,最流行的免费SSL证书提供者是Let's Encrypt,这是一个由互联网安全研究实验室(ISRG)运营的免费、自动化和开放的证书颁发机构。以下是申请Let's Encrypt SSL证书的基本步骤: 1. **安装Certbot**:Certbot是一个开源工具,可以帮助自动化SSL证书的申请和续签过程。您可以从Let's Encrypt的官方网站下载并安装Certbot。Certbot支持多种操作系统和Web服务器。 2. **运行Certbot**:安装完成后,您需要运行Certbot命令来申请证书。根据您的Web服务器类型(如Apache或Nginx),Certbot会提供相应的命令。例如,对于Apache,您可能会运行类似`certbot --apache`的命令。 3. **验证域名所有权**:在申请过程中,Let's Encrypt需要验证您对域名的所有权。Certbot会为您的网站添加一个特殊的文件,Let's Encrypt会检查这个文件以确认您是域名的所有者。 4. **安装证书**:一旦验证通过,Certbot将自动为您的Web服务器安装SSL证书。您不需要手动进行任何配置。 5. **设置自动续签**:Let's Encrypt的证书有效期为90天,Certbot可以自动为您续签证书,确保您的网站始终保持HTTPS加密状态。 **注意事项** - 确保您的Web服务器运行正常,并且域名已经正确配置DNS解析。 - 免费SSL证书适合个人和小型企业使用,但对于需要更高级别的信任和安全性的大型企业或组织,可能需要考虑购买付费的SSL证书。 - 定期检查和更新您的SSL证书,以确保网站的安全性。 通过上述步骤,您可以为您的网站申请免费的SSL证书,提高网站的安全性和信任度。Let's Encrypt提供了一个简单且免费的方式来保护您的网站和用户数据,使互联网变得更加安全。 感谢您阅读本文,如果有相关疑问或者需求,请随时联系我们。